oracle.jbo.html.jsp.datatags
Class DataSourceTag
java.lang.Object
|
+--javax.servlet.jsp.tagext.TagSupport
|
+--oracle.jbo.html.jsp.datatags.DataSourceTag
- All Implemented Interfaces:
- javax.servlet.jsp.tagext.IterationTag, java.io.Serializable, javax.servlet.jsp.tagext.Tag
- public class DataSourceTag
- extends javax.servlet.jsp.tagext.TagSupport
- See Also:
- Serialized Form
| Fields inherited from class javax.servlet.jsp.tagext.TagSupport |
id, pageContext |
| Fields inherited from interface javax.servlet.jsp.tagext.IterationTag |
EVAL_BODY_AGAIN |
| Fields inherited from interface javax.servlet.jsp.tagext.Tag |
EVAL_BODY_INCLUDE, EVAL_PAGE, SKIP_BODY, SKIP_PAGE |
| Methods inherited from class javax.servlet.jsp.tagext.TagSupport |
doAfterBody, doEndTag, findAncestorWithClass, getId, getParent, getValue, getValues, removeValue, setId, setPageContext, setParent, setValue |
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
amId
protected java.lang.String amId
sViewObject
protected java.lang.String sViewObject
sWhere
protected java.lang.String sWhere
sOrder
protected java.lang.String sOrder
nRangeSize
protected int nRangeSize
bForwardOnly
protected boolean bForwardOnly
sIterMode
protected java.lang.String sIterMode
ds
protected DataSource ds
DataSourceTag
public DataSourceTag()
setAppid
public void setAppid(java.lang.String amId)
setViewobject
public void setViewobject(java.lang.String sViewObject)
setWhereclause
public void setWhereclause(java.lang.String sWhere)
setOrderbyclause
public void setOrderbyclause(java.lang.String sOrder)
setRangesize
public void setRangesize(java.lang.String sValue)
throws java.lang.NumberFormatException
setForwardonly
public void setForwardonly(java.lang.String sValue)
setItermode
public void setItermode(java.lang.String sValue)
getDataSource
public DataSource getDataSource()
doStartTag
public int doStartTag()
throws javax.servlet.jsp.JspException
- Process the start tag for this instance.
The doStartTag() method assumes that all setter methods have been
invoked before.
When this method is invoked, the body has not yet been invoked.
- Overrides:
doStartTag in class javax.servlet.jsp.tagext.TagSupport
release
public void release()
- release() called after doEndTag() to reset state
- Overrides:
release in class javax.servlet.jsp.tagext.TagSupport